2000 pontiac gtp vs 1997 v6 camaro
Which would have a better 0-60 and quarter mile time?
A 1997 camaro v6 auto. Cai 308 gears or a 2000 Pontiac gtp v6 supercharged auto with cai.
Which would win before bolt ins and which would win after?

Re: 2000 pontiac gtp vs 1997 v6 camaro
GTP will win stock to stock and mod to mod. At the wheels they have 30 more horsepower and almost 100lbs more torque. They are the near the same weight as an Fbody. When mine was stock I raced a 5spd 3.8 camaro and it was closer but once I got traction (fwd and supercharged motor sucks for traction) it was over.
With a 3.4 pulley, cai, and some minor exhaust mods, they will do high 13's. Tune, headers, and a smaller pulley, they will do low 13's. Cam, smaller pulley, intercooler they will do low 12's, high 11s with traction.
They are fun cars. They get awesome gas mileage, hold a bunch of people, super comfy, heads up display is so cool, and has a gigantic trunk. I want another one as a daily driver so bad.
